Study on phenotypic diversity of seed and fruit in natural populations of Camellia reticulate f.simplex in the west of Yunnan,China

Abstract: Six phenotypic traits were investigated in 12 natural populations of Camellia reticulate f.simplex from west of Yunnan, China,by using nested variance analysis, correlation analysis, variance analysis, phenotypic differentiation coefficient(VST)and cluster analysis, etc. The results showed that there were significant variance among and within populations; the variation within populations was much greater than that among populations. The fruit variation coefficients of the seed weight per fruit(42.99%),the fruit weight(38.17%), the seed weight(31.66%),among 4 natural populations had the greatest variance, the fruit height(15.69%),the fruit diameter(14.01%)and the fruit shape index(13.75%)had the least variance, among 12 natural populations MS1(30.05%)had the greatest variance, the MS3 had the least(15.3%)variance, the mean variance, among 12 natural populations was 24.83%. There were significant variance among 6 phenotypic traits except the fruit height and the fruit weight. The Person index between the fruit diameter and the fruit weight was 0.90.The fruit height were significant positive relationship with longitude and altitude, but were negative correlation with latitude.
